电气编程用什么系统好
-
选择电气编程系统时,需要考虑多个方面的因素。以下是几个常用的电气编程系统,供您参考。
-
Siemens Step 7:西门子公司开发的一款集成化编程软件,广泛应用于工业自动化控制系统。Step 7具有强大的编程功能,并支持多种编程语言,如Ladder Diagram(LD)、Structured Text(ST)和Function Block Diagram(FBD)等。此外,Step 7还提供了丰富的调试和监控功能,使程序的开发和调试更加高效。
-
Allen-Bradley RSLogix:罗克韦尔自动化公司开发的一套成熟的电气编程软件。RSLogix支持多种编程语言,如Ladder Diagram(LD)、Structured Text(ST)和Sequential Function Chart(SFC)等,满足不同项目的编程需求。此外,RSLogix还有较为完善的在线调试和诊断功能,有利于故障排除和维护。
-
CODESYS:CODESYS是一套开放型的电气编程软件平台,支持多种硬件设备和操作系统。CODESYS具有灵活的编程环境和强大的可扩展性,可以满足各种不同规模和复杂度的项目需求。同时,CODESYS还具备友好的用户界面和丰富的第三方库,方便开发人员快速构建高质量的应用程序。
-
Mitsubishi GX Works:三菱电机开发的一款强大的电气编程软件。GX Works支持多种编程语言,如Ladder Diagram(LD)、Structured Text(ST)和Function Block Diagram(FBD)等,同时具备丰富的调试和测试工具。此外,GX Works还提供了直观的开发界面和用户友好的操作,适合初学者和有经验的开发人员使用。
以上是一些常用的电气编程系统,每个系统都有自己的特点和适用范围。选择合适的系统,需要根据项目需求、个人经验和技术要求来综合考虑。最终的选择应该是能够满足项目需求并提高开发效率的系统。
1年前 -
-
对于电气编程,有几个常用的系统可以选择,以下是其中几个较为出色的系统:
-
PLC(可编程逻辑控制器)系统:PLC系统是目前最常见和使用最广泛的电气编程系统之一。PLC系统具有可靠性高、适应性强、可扩展性好等优点,可以应用于各种工业自动化控制环境。PLC系统的编程语言一般使用Ladder Diagram(梯形图)或者Structured Text(结构化文本),易于学习和理解。
-
DCS(分散控制系统):DCS系统主要用于对大型工业过程进行控制和监视。它使用了高级编程语言(如C/C++、Python等)以及基于流程控制算法的软件工具,并具有网络通信和数据采集等功能。DCS系统通常适用于需要进行复杂控制和监测的工业环境。
-
SCADA(监视、控制和数据采集系统):SCADA系统用于实时监视、控制和数据采集等功能。它可以与PLC或DCS系统结合使用,用于管理和监测各种过程和设备。SCADA系统通常使用图形化编程软件,如Function Block Diagram(功能块图)或Sequential Function Chart(顺序功能图)。
-
HMI(人机界面)系统:HMI系统提供了一种直观的图形界面,供操作员与机器进行交互。HMI系统的编程语言通常使用可视化编程软件,如VBScript、C#等。
-
软件定义控制(SDC)系统:SDC系统是一种新兴的控制系统,它使用软件代替传统的硬件来实现控制功能。SDC系统通常使用高级编程语言(如Python、Java等)进行开发和编程,在可编程硬件上运行。SDC系统具有灵活性高、可扩展性好等优点,可以适用于各种控制应用。
1年前 -
-
选择一个适合的电气编程系统对于项目的开发和实施至关重要。以下是一些常用的电气编程系统。
- PLC 编程系统
PLC(可编程逻辑控制器)是一种常见的电气控制设备,用于自动化过程的控制。PLC编程系统通常由软件和硬件组成,常用的PLC编程系统有Siemens Step 7、Rockwell RSLogix系列等。
操作流程:
- 首先,选择适合的PLC编程系统软件,并进行安装。
- 确定系统硬件需求,并选择合适的PLC控制器。
- 创建一个新的程序文件,并进行编程以实现所需的控制逻辑。
- 调试和测试程序,确保它的正常工作。
- 将编程后的程序下载到PLC控制器中。
- 对控制系统进行验证和调整,确保其满足项目需求。
- 嵌入式系统编程
嵌入式系统是一种在特定的硬件平台上运行的电子设备,用于执行特定的任务。嵌入式系统编程通常需要使用特定的开发工具和编程语言,如C语言、C++等。
操作流程:
- 选择适合的嵌入式开发工具,如ARM Keil、TI Code Composer Studio等。
- 编写嵌入式程序的源代码,使用合适的编程语言和库。
- 配置硬件平台的相关参数,如时钟频率、IO口等。
- 编译源代码,并生成可执行文件或固件。
- 将可执行文件或固件下载到目标硬件平台中。
- 对系统进行测试和调试,确保其正常运行。
- SCADA/HMI 编程系统
SCADA(监控与数据采集系统)和HMI(人机界面)是用于远程监控和控制自动化过程的软件系统。SCADA/HMI编程系统通常具有图形化编程界面,并提供丰富的库和组件供用户选择。
操作流程:
- 选择适合的SCADA/HMI编程系统软件,并进行安装。
- 创建一个新的项目,并选择合适的界面布局和风格。
- 添加所需的控制元素,如按钮、图表、报警显示等。
- 配置数据采集和通信功能,确保能够与设备进行数据交换。
- 进行界面的美化和定制,使其易于操作和理解。
- 对系统进行测试和调试,确保其正常工作。
- 将程序部署到目标设备,并进行远程监控和控制。
在选择电气编程系统时,需要根据具体项目要求和自身技术背景,综合考虑系统的功能、易用性、可靠性和成本等因素,选取最合适的系统。此外,可以参考其他工程师的经验和意见,与供应商进行沟通和咨询,以获取更多专业的建议。
1年前 - PLC 编程系统